Raya vs Raya Aletas Juntas
Bathyraja papilionifera compared with Bathyraja cousseauae
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Raya | Raya Aletas Juntas |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class same | Elasmobranchii | Elasmobranchii |
| Order same | Rajiformes (Rajiformes) | Rajiformes (Rajiformes) |
| Family same | Arhynchobatidae | Arhynchobatidae |
| Genus same | Bathyraja | Bathyraja |
| Species | Bathyraja papilionifera | Bathyraja cousseauae |
Evolutionary Relationship
Raya and Raya Aletas Juntas share a common ancestor at the Genus level: Bathyraja.
